What you’ll do in this role:
- Manage portfolio cash transactions and balances
- Prepare cash flow analysis, summary documentation and spreadsheets
- Facilitate debt service maintenance
- Generate, interpret and communicate financial performance returns
- Maintain and enhance portfolio reporting
- Collaborate with Convexity’s acquisition and development teams to perform project cost projections and budgeting
- Compile and review financial statements and expense reconciliations for various real estate investments and operating properties
- Assemble quarterly compliance reports including financial statements, contingency schedules and covenant calculations
- Review and approve construction draws as well as funding/payment requests for accuracy
- Interact directly with third party joint venture partners to generate accurate accounting reporting information
